According to the DVGW work sheet W551, dwelling
stations are small installations if the pipe content
of each potable water pipe behind the station
does not exceed 3 litres. As a result, the following
pipe lengths for copper and stainless steel pipes
must not be exceeded:

2.5 Temperature settings
NOTICE
When leaving the factory, the potable water
temperature is set to approx. 50 °C (position 3 at
the temperature controller).
The system temperatures must comply with the
legal requirements.
WARNING
High system temperatures may enhance corrosion
and the formation of calcium deposits. The speci-
fying engineer and the user of the system are re-
sponsible to evaluate these factors and to take pre-
ventive measures if required (e.g. water treatment).
WARNING
Risk of scalding Outlet temperatures exceeding
43°C can lead to scalding.

3.2 Storage
The dwelling station "Regudis W-HTF" with high tem-
perature circuit must only be stored under the following
conditions:
– Do not store in open air, keep dry and free from dust.
– Do not expose to aggressive fluids or heat sources.
– Protect from direct sunlight and mechanical
agitation.
– Storage temperature: –20 °C up to +60 °C,
max. relative humidity of air: 95 %
